[gaim-migrate @ 15516] We no longer send the closing of the jabber stream if we were forcibly disconnected (e.g. the Internet connection dropped and we lost our connection to the Jabber server). For non-ssl jabber connections, this doesn't change anything. For ssl jabber connections, this prevents a possible crash if the ssl connection is now invalid... which is not a problem for the more-commonly-used Mozilla library and for GnuTLS but is a problem for OpenSSL. committer: Tailor Script <tailor@pidgin.im>
